** An exciting opportunity for a Senior Software Engineer to join the Next Gen Core Accounts platform team.
As a Senior Software Engineer, you will play a key role in transforming our Core Banking Platform by leveraging modern technologies and innovative approaches such as Google Cloud Platform (GCP) and microservices-based architecture. You’ll bring a strong technical background, ideally with experience in building microservice or event-driven systems. Drawing on your expertise, you will propose and establish engineering standards, drive technical excellence, and coach other team members, ensuring they are adopting best practice and designing secure, resilient platform that is easy to maintain.

** What you’ll do…
*** Actively contribute to the codebase while collaborating with architects and cross-functional teams to design scalable software solutions.
* Build strong relationships and support team development through mentoring and coaching, with a focus on collective success.
* Develop a deep understanding of the business domain and processes to effectively translate user needs into stories and technical tasks.
* Drive efficient breakdowns of work, ensuring non-functional requirements like security and performance are well considered.
* Partner with the Engineering Lead and other teams to enhance ways of working across the lab by proposing and testing innovative approaches.
** What you’ll need…
*** Strong expertise in Object-Oriented Design and back-end development with deep knowledge of Java.
* Solid understanding of software fundamentals such as threading, memory management, debugging, and clean coding practices.
* Proven ability to drive technical delivery and communicate effectively, promote agile ways of working, and mentor others.
* Experience in application and solution design, with a focus on managing technical debt and delivering high-quality engineering outcomes.
* Comfort in both technical and business conversations, with a delivery-focused mindset.
Nice to have
* Experience with Test-Driven Development and test automation
* Familiarity with Domain-Driven Design
* Knowledge of Microservices, Spring Boot, REST protocol, Apache Kafka
* Exposure to Docker and Kubernetes for containerized development and deployment
* Knowledge of Google Cloud Platform
